Transaction 3576217ce4449bc33bc53c3269fafe6f4b9a4a4c78c66a528621aae203eb14ef
1 Input
2 Outputs
- 3576217ce4449bc33bc53c3269fafe6f4b9a4a4c78c66a528621aae203eb14ef:0
- 3576217ce4449bc33bc53c3269fafe6f4b9a4a4c78c66a528621aae203eb14ef:1
value 527557
address 34tMgKLhkzSpAkJTTRjS4gGCJ6KkLJcvFi
value 129930259
address 3JAZjpSbqkwix8saSavKxj8iPD5u6yzRbt